The trouble under your feet, in the walls, and behind the fridge

Pest issues fall under three pails. Structural insects, such as termites, carpenter ants, and powderpost beetles, endanger the structure itself. Hygiene bugs, such as roaches, flies, and rodents, grow on food sources and wetness. Periodic invaders, like silverfish or vermins, exploit openings and problems but do not necessarily nest in your home. Each group requires a various technique, and an excellent pest control company will certainly customize the strategy accordingly.

When I walked a 1920s bungalow with a new house owner that maintained hearing pale rustling in the evening, the first professional she called suggested a perennial basic solution, regular monthly gos to, and a rodent bait terminal plan for the exterior. He never climbed up into the attic. A rival invested fifteen mins with a headlamp in the eaves, after that showed us a two-inch gap at the fascia and multiple droppings along the knee wall surface. The second specialist sealed the entrance factor, established catches in certain runway locations, eliminated the carcasses, and complied with up twice. This task price much less than 2 months of the initial strategy and ended the problem within a week. Good pest control begins with evaluation, not with a sales script.

What a trustworthy examination looks like

If the initial browse through lasts 5 minutes and ends with a laminated cost sheet, maintain looking. A proper assessment has a rhythm. Outdoors, a professional circles around the structure, downspouts, and plant life clearance, checking for conducive problems such as wood-to-soil contact, wet compost versus house siding, and gaps at energy infiltrations. Inside, they follow dampness and warmth. Kitchens, washrooms, utility rooms, cellar sills, and attic room air flow all get a look. They might ask to move the oven drawer or look under a sink base. If rats are presumed, they look for rub marks, droppings, and gnaw factors at door edges. For termites, they look for shelter tubes, blistered paint, or soft areas in walls. For bed pests, they peel back seams and check tufts.

An experienced exterminator narrates as they go, even if briefly. You will certainly hear remarks like, "These droppings follow mice, not rats," or "These wings are termite swarmer wings, see the equal length." They might use a wetness meter on questionable timber or a flashlight at ground level to detect ants tracking during the warmth of the day. The tools do not require to be elegant. Curiosity matters more than equipment.

Credentials that actually matter

Licensing and insurance are the bare minimum. You want a pest control company that holds the proper state licenses for structural pest control and, when required, a separate license for bed pest or termite treatments. Ask to see proof of general responsibility and employees' payment insurance policy. I have seen attic room joists snapped by a reckless step, overspray on a vehicle, and ladder dents in seamless gutters. Insurance coverage exists since mishaps happen.

Beyond licensing, try to find evidence of proceeding education and learning. In many states, service technicians need a variety of CEUs every year to maintain their credential. When a business invests in training, you see it in the area choices. Throughout a warm front one summertime, I enjoyed a tech swap out a liquid ant bait for a gel since the colony had shifted to healthy protein. That decision comes from technique and training.

Experience by bug type matters more than years in company. A more recent pest control contractor who deals with bed pests weekly frequently outshines a large exterminator company that sends out a generalist two times a year. Ask, "The amount of bed insect work have you finished this year? What is your re-treatment price? What are the typical causes when they stop working?" Pay Rodenticide attention for certain numbers or varieties and frank explanations.

The plan must match the parasite, the structure, and your tolerance

A decent exterminator service will propose an integrated technique. You might hear the phrase IPM, integrated bug monitoring. Water, food, and harborage reduction come first. Chemical controls, when used, are accurate and targeted.

For rats, a great plan starts with exemption. Seal quarter-sized openings for mice, larger for rats, with steel woollen and caulk or equipment cloth. Traps inside, lure terminals outside where enabled, and cleanliness steps like sealed family pet food go together. If a proposition leans on poisonous substance inside living rooms without a plan to eliminate carcasses or seal entrance factors, that is sloppy and short-sighted.

For roaches, cleanliness and accessibility issue as much as chemical choice. I as soon as dealt with a dining establishment that cut German roach matters by 80 percent in 3 weeks just by closing flooring drain gaps with stainless inserts and including nighttime wipe-down methods. The pest control company switched to a turning of development regulators and lures, applied as pin-sized beads, not broadcast sprays. The combination stuck since the setting changed.

For termites, the choice often comes down to soil treatments versus baits. A liquid termiticide develops a cured area that termites can not cross. It uses immediate defense but calls for boring and trenching. Lure systems, such as those installed around the boundary, can get rid of nests with time and are much less intrusive, however they need tracking and persistence. An excellent exterminator outlines both paths with pros, disadvantages, and costs, then indicates conditions on your building that idea the choice. Heavy clay dirt, high water tables, slab building, or historic block can all influence the therapy choice.

For bed insects, heat, chemical, or incorporated approaches all work when implemented well. Whole-home warm therapies get to deadly temperature levels for a continual time. They require prep work, eliminate chemical deposits, and can be pricey. Chemical therapies with careful crack and crevice applications and cleaning in spaces cost less however require several gos to. A business that offers both, or that companions with a specialist, is normally much more versatile and straightforward regarding compromises.

Price, value, and the cost of inexpensive promises

Pricing varies by region and infestation. For a common single-family home, basic pest control may run 300 to 600 bucks per year for quarterly solution. Bed pest work frequently vary from 750 to 2,500 dollars depending on spaces and approach. Termite lure systems can begin near 800 to 1,500 dollars for install, plus annual surveillance costs, while dirt treatments for a mid-sized home might run 1,200 to 2,500 dollars. Rodent exemption can differ wildly, from a couple of hundred for securing tiny voids to several thousand for hefty structural work.

The lowest quote can be a catch. Right here are the questions I ask when two proposals are much apart:

  • What specifically is consisted of in the first service and the follow-ups? The amount of sees and on what schedule?
  • Which items or approaches will certainly you utilize, at what areas, and why those over alternatives?
  • What conditions do you need me to deal with, and just how will certainly we validate that each side did their part?
  • What does your assurance pledge and leave out, and how do I ask for a retreat?
  • Who will certainly be my continuous specialist, and exactly how do I reach them in between visits?

If the reduced bid includes less visits, less tracking, or no extent for exemption, it is not apples to apples. Sometimes, a higher proposal covers repair services, sealing, and hygiene gadgets that avoid persisting expenses. On one multifamily property, a business suggested glue catches and month-to-month spray downs for mice. An additional bid was 40 percent higher and included sealing 35 infiltrations, installing door sweeps, and getting rid of the dumpster overflow. home sealing The 2nd strategy minimized call-backs by 90 percent within two months, and the total year price was lower.

Red flags that predict headaches

Most troubles I have seen after the truth were foreseeable from the first call. Companies that guarantee an irreversible solution to an open setting issue, like mice in a city rowhouse with falling apart mortar, are offering hope, not a service. Guarantees that include several exclusions, such as "no insurance coverage for re-infestation from bordering systems," are not always negative, however they need to be discussed, not hidden behind fine print. If a sales rep stands up to documenting details, prevent them. If a professional waits to show you item labels or safety and security data sheets upon request, keep your budget in your pocket.

Beware of one-size-fits-all quarterly strategies that assert to cover whatever with no evaluation costs or attachments. When you review the agreement, you might discover that bed bugs, termites, wild animals, and German roaches are excluded. That sort of strategy fits, specifically for seasonal ants or occasional spiders, however it will certainly not help organic pest solutions with high-pressure pests.

Another indication is overspray or unnecessary broad applications. If you see a service technician misting the walls in every room for ants, they are treating the sign, not the reason. The swarm is outside. That chemical does little greater than leave deposit where your children and pets live. You desire targeted lures, crack and gap applications behind button plates, or border boundary treatments that attend to the path, not inside misting for show.

Contracts and guarantees that mean something

A good assurance has clear triggers and solutions. It should specify the protected parasites, how long coverage lasts, what re-treatments price, and what actions nullify the assurance. For termites, you will see fixing assurances, retreat-only warranties, or hybrid versions. Repair assurances can be valuable if you rely on the company's long life and their procedure, yet they are typically much more costly. Retreat-only can be completely great if you monitor yearly and maintain a record of clean inspections.

Read for transferability and cancellation terms. If you prepare to market within a couple of years, a transferable termite bond can aid the sale. On the various other hand, some general pest control agreements auto-renew with stiff termination fees. If you see early discontinuation charges that exceed the remainder of the service value, work out or walk.

Payment terms tell you regarding a company's confidence. Sensible deposits for significant work are regular. Complete prepayment for unrendered services is not, unless a discount makes up and you rely on the service provider. For bed bugs, vendors in some cases stage repayments throughout sees, which lines up incentives.

Safety and environmental considerations without the slogans

Homeowners usually ask for "environmentally friendly" services. The term is unclear. What issues is direct exposure, not marketing language. The best pest control minimizes the requirement for chemicals with exemption and cleanliness, then utilizes the least-toxic efficient item in the tiniest quantity, in the most targeted location, for the shortest time. That could be a desiccant dust in a wall surface void, a gel lure under a counter top lip, or a development regulator in a drain. For insects, it may be larvicide in standing water and a remedied quality for runoff.

Ask the service technician to walk you via the items they plan to use. Review the energetic ingredients on the tag, not simply the trade name. If you have animals, fish tanks, or children with asthma, claim so early. Good companies note those information in your data and adjust solutions and application approaches. I have seen technicians swap out pyrethroids near aquarium or prevent aerosol providers near oxygen devices. These are tiny changes that make a big difference.

Ventilation after therapy is usually uncomplicated. Straightforward open-window durations, commonly 30 to 60 mins, are enough for several interior applications. For warm treatments, they will certainly set the time and tracking tools. For sulfuryl fluoride airing outs, which are rare for single-family homes beyond certain termite or whole-structure scenarios, the safety procedures are stringent, with clear re-entry times. If your supplier seems casual regarding re-entry, that is a concern.

When wildlife creeps right into the picture

Not every pest control service deals with wild animals. Squirrels in the attic, raccoons in the soffit, or bats in the smokeshaft need a different permit in lots of states and a various capability. Wildlife control focuses on humane trapping, one-way doors, and repair work of access points, often complied with by sterilizing infected insulation. If you suspect wildlife, ask straight whether the exterminator company has that capacity or partners with a wild animals professional. A general pest control specialist that sets a few traps without sealing accessibility points will certainly develop a cycle of return sees without resolution.

What readiness looks like on your side

Clients influence end results. A tidy, available, and well-prepared home enables technicians to bring their ideal job. For roaches, bag and remove the pantry items the night prior to so they can access gaps and hinges. For bed bugs, comply with the prep list exactly, however beware of over-prepping. Landing every item pest control contractor and moving small furnishings throughout spaces can disperse insects. A great business will give specific, gauged directions such as laundering bed linens on high warmth, decluttering under beds, and leaving furnishings in position for correct treatment.

In leasings, working with accessibility and holding both occupant and landlord liable matters as much as treatment choice. In one structure with persisting roach issues, the manager created prep instructions in 3 languages, added picture-based guides on how to empty cabinets, and sent out a staff member the day before to aid senior residents lift light products. Treatment effectiveness improved by half without altering chemicals.

Seasonality, local quirks, and unique cases

Pest pressure is not uniform. In the Southeast, fire ants and below ground termites use consistent stress. In the Southwest, scorpions and roof covering rats produce various patterns. In the Northeast, rodents surge in fall as temperature levels decrease. High elevation communities see collection flies gather on south-facing wall surfaces in late summer season. Your selection of pest control company need to show regional experience. Ask what seasonal pests they prepare for and exactly how they readjust timetables. A quarterly timetable might shift to bi-monthly during peak months and two times a year in winter months, or the contrary for sure pests.

For historic homes, porous rock foundations and balloon framing complicate exclusion. You may need a contractor that comprehends how to seal without suffocating, just how to preserve air flow while blocking access, and just how to deal with timber members sensitively. For green roofings or pollinator yards, you desire a group that can secure advantageous insects while attending to parasites that intimidate people and structures.

What is the hardest pest to get rid of?

Bed bugs are widely considered among the hardest pests to eliminate because they hide in very small cracks and can survive many common treatments. German cockroaches are also difficult due to rapid reproduction and increasing resistance to certain insecticides. Termites can be challenging because colonies may be hidden inside structures or underground. Rodents can be persistent when entry points and food sources are not fully addressed.

What kind of pest control is cheapest?

The cheapest approach is usually prevention and exclusion, such as sealing entry points and reducing food and water sources. For active pests, basic traps or baits for common insects or rodents are typically lower cost than full-structure or specialty treatments. Costs rise when the pest requires multiple visits, specialized equipment, or whole-home treatment methods. Cheaper methods can be less effective if the underlying entry or harborage problem remains.

How to 100% get rid of mice?

A guaranteed “100%” outcome is not realistic without ongoing prevention because mice can re-enter if access and attractants remain. The most effective approach is integrated: seal entry points, remove food sources, and use traps or professionally placed baits based on activity patterns. Success is measured by no new droppings, no sounds, and no trap activity over time. Continued monitoring is necessary because a small missed entry point can restart the problem.

What are three signs that you have a rat infestation?

Common signs include rodent droppings, gnaw marks on wood/plastic/wiring, and scratching or scurrying sounds in walls or ceilings. You may also see greasy rub marks along baseboards where rats travel repeatedly. Nests made from shredded paper or insulation can indicate active harborage. Fresh droppings and new gnawing typically suggest current activity rather than an old problem.

Is it possible to 100% get rid of bed bugs?

Complete elimination is possible, but “100% guaranteed” is difficult because bed bugs hide in tiny spaces and can be reintroduced via luggage, furniture, or adjacent units. Effective eradication typically requires a combination of methods such as heat treatment and targeted insecticides, plus strict follow-up. Multiple visits are common because eggs may survive an initial treatment. Ongoing monitoring is used to confirm the infestation is gone.
